We are seeking a Lead Platform Architect to serve as the primary architect and strategic leader for our global infrastructure. In this role, you will be the guardian of our core platform products while steering the organization toward a future defined by financial efficiency, ironclad security, and AI-driven automation.
You will act as the bridge between technical execution and executive strategy, providing the high-level oversight and mentorship necessary to keep our Platform Engineering team aligned with the company's long-term vision.
Job requirements
  • Architectural Mastery: 8+ years in Platform/DevOps/SysOps with deep expertise in GCP, Self-Managed Kubernetes, and Bare-Metal (Hetzner).
  • Mentorship Experience: Proven track record of conducting rigorous architecture/code reviews and mentoring mid-to-senior level engineers.
  • Security & Compliance: Experience leading successful audits (SOC2/GDPR) and implementing CSPM solutions.
  • Product Thinking: Ability to treat internal tools (Sandbox, Observability) as products with long-term roadmaps and "customers" (internal developers and students).
Strategic Communication: Ability to translate complex infrastructure risks and technical debt into business-level discussions for the C-suite.
Preferred Certifications
  • CKA (Certified Kubernetes Administrator)
  • CKS (Certified Kubernetes Security Specialist)
  • Google Professional Cloud Architect
  • Google Professional Cloud Security Engineer
  • CyberSecurity Professional

Job responsibilities
1. Key Strategic & Technical Pillars1. Technical Leadership & Mentorship
  • Engineering Oversight: Act as the primary reviewer for all architectural designs, infrastructure changes, and code produced by the Platform Engineering team.
  • Mentorship: Provide consistent, high-level technical guidance to the Platform Engineers, ensuring they have the support and feedback needed to execute complex migrations and builds.
  • Standards Enforcement: Define and enforce organization-wide engineering standards to ensure a sane, consistent, and secure product outlook.
2. Product Ownership: Sandbox & Observability
  • Sandbox Automation: Take ownership of our in-house GCP Sandbox solution. Monitor progress on ephemeral environment automation, providing critical inputs on "self-destruct" logic, cost-control guardrails, and user experience.
  • Observability Stack: Maintain and evolve the unified observability framework (Monitoring, Alerting, Logging). Ensure the stack provides actionable data not just for engineers, but for business stakeholders as well.
3. Executive Strategy & AI Innovation
  • C-Suite Collaboration: Participate in strategic calls with executives. Represent the engineering department’s health, budget, and technological roadmap.
  • AI & Agentic Solutions: Research and embed cutting-edge AI and agentic solutions into our internal engineering services.
  • AI Governance: Partner with the CTO to define and govern the Organization-wide AI Policy, ensuring that AI adoption across all departments is optimized, secure, and compliant.
4. FinOps & Org-Wide Optimization
  • Financial Stewardship: Drive organization-wide FinOps initiatives within GCP. Manage budgets across multiple projects, optimize CUDs, and ensure infrastructure costs scale efficiently with business growth.
  • Cross-Collaboration: Work with department heads to ensure their project-specific infra requirements stay in line with defined financial guardrails.
5. Cybersecurity & Compliance
  • Security Initiatives: Drive CSPM (Cloud Security Posture Management) and Vulnerability Management (VM) workflows. Enforce standards across GCP, MongoDB, Redis, and other critical data stores.
Compliance Lead: Lead efforts to achieve and maintain SOC2 Type 2 and GDPR compliance. Build a flexible compliance framework that can adapt to future global regulatory requirements.

What you need to know about the Chennai Tech Scene

To locals, it's no secret that South India is leading the charge in big data infrastructure. While the environmental impact of data centers has long been a concern, emerging hubs like Chennai are favored by companies seeking ready access to renewable energy resources, which provide more sustainable and cost-effective solutions. As a result, Chennai, along with neighboring Bengaluru and Hyderabad, is poised for significant growth, with a projected 65 percent increase in data center capacity over the next decade.
